Output 57587389b2ac53330fc3d101a3ccbc03e71d53033c024dd0efdf046aef78a7ab:0

value
195804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2970824e5a3d61e226bb73c8d0633a8df1567be5 OP_EQUAL
address
35U8QfuwgdcDeCuzDFAxPGrQmZZw2KYgGo
transaction
57587389b2ac53330fc3d101a3ccbc03e71d53033c024dd0efdf046aef78a7ab
spent
true